  • 简介:摘要:勘探布置和深度确定是岩土工程勘察中非常重要的一环,也是提高勘察技术工作质量的需要。在岩土工程勘察阶段,通过根据规范缩短勘探之间的距离,加深勘察点深度的方式来了解现场施工环境是不可取的,既增加了勘探工作量和勘探工作的周期,同时也降低了技术工作布置的科学性。勘探的布置间距和勘探深度与场地土层分布特性密切相关,勘探的合理布置决定场地土层的完整性,而勘探深度的合理确定能够在探明地基土层情况下减少勘察工作量。因此,勘探布置间距和勘探深度应共同发挥作用,以查明建设场地的地质情况。

  • 简介:摘要:随着中国城市化建设持续高速发展,高层建筑已成为工程建设领域内一种主流趋势,相比较普通建筑,高层建筑岩土工程易受到工程地质条件的影响,因此,在勘察期间,能够准确查明场地工程地质情况对保障高层建筑整体结构的稳定性显得尤为重要。岩土工程勘察成果不仅是影响勘察质量的重要环节,也为后续设计、施工提供经济合理参数的重要支撑。在接到建筑工程勘察项目意向后,首先要确定建设工程勘察方案,勘察方案的合理性决定着勘探工作量,也显著影响着岩土工程勘察质量。

  • 简介:Large-scaleMIMO(multiple-inputmultiple-output)systemswithnumerouslow-powerantennascanprovidebetterperformanceintermsofspectrumefficiency,powersavingandlinkreliabilitythanconventionalMIMO.Forlarge-scaleMIMO,thereareseveraltechnicalissuesthatneedtobepracticallyaddressed(e.g.,pilotpatterndesignandlow-powertransmissiondesign)andtheoreticallyaddressed(e.g.,capacitybound,channelestimation,andpowerallocationstrategies).Inthispaper,weanalyzethesumrateupperboundoflarge-scaleMIMO,investigateitskeytechnologiesincludingchannelestimation,downlinkprecoding,anduplinkdetection.Wealsopresentsomeperspectivesconcerningnewchannelmodelingapproaches,advanceduserschedulingalgorithms,etc.

  • 简介:AbstractMandibular condylar fractures are among the most common facial fractures and some of the most difficult to manage. Opinions about the management of mandibular condylar fractures differ among surgeons. With the implementation of new technology, an increased understanding of fracture management, and better functional and morphological outcomes reported in the literature, open reduction and internal fixation is becoming many surgeons’ preferred choice for the treatment of condylar fractures. Because surgical treatment of such fractures is complex, certain factors must be considered to achieve satisfactory outcomes. In this article, we summarise six key points in the management of mandibular condylar fractures: virtual evaluation of condylar fracture, a suitable surgical approach, good reduction, stable internal fixation, repair of the articular disc, and restoration of the mandibular arch width. We believe that these points will help to improve the prognosis of mandibular condyle fractures.
